ASC CDL
Also called: Color Decision List
ELI5
A simple standard for sharing basic colour adjustments between systems.
Used in conversation
“Send the ASC CDL with the dailies so editorial sees the intended basic grade.”
Definition
A standard set of slope, offset, power and saturation values used to exchange basic colour decisions.

Connected terms
- Look-up tableA LUT maps input values through a fixed transform; CDL stores a small set of adjustable colour parameters for exchange.
